What we look for in a teaching candidat
e
At KIPP, we believe that an excellent teacher:
Has a commitment to seeing life-long, transformative outcomes for students in college and beyond
Uses student achievement data to set ambitious academic goals with students and focuses on their results
Believes that teaching character
is
as important to our students' success as the development of their academic skills
Exudes joy and a love for teaching and learning in the classroom every single day
Demonstrates a growth mindset in order to continuously improve as a teacher, and is open to frequent observations, feedback and coaching
Believes in creating innovative lessons that focus on the needs of all students
Thrives working side-by-side with a team of like-minded individuals
Qualified Candidates Have:
At least two years of teaching experience (required)
A bachelor’s degree (required)
Experience working in urban schools (highly preferred)
State teaching credentials (preferred)
An incredible work ethic
A belief in the mission and values of KIPP
